Job Description

The Senior Cloud Engineer is responsible for the planning, building and maintenance of Java/JVM distributed services deployed to the cloud, using modern container-based orchestration technologies. This role will work with a Cloud Architect on building code as infrastructure, and developing the CI/CD pipeline. This role will also collaborate with other development teams and team members to plan improvements, new products, features, and integrations. This is a full-time position with remote, hybrid and on-site opportunities available.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in the Software Engineering field or related role
  • Minimum of 3 years experience in designing, building, and shipping high-availability production distributed services
  • AWS certification (Solutions Architect, DevOps Engineer, or equivalent)
  • Experience managing workloads in AWS
  • Strong knowledge of ECS/Fargate and experience with AWS service integration
  • Experience with designing and maintaining container-based scalable distributed architectures
  • Extensive experience building, optimizing, and maintaining containers
  • Experience with data/database design to support distributed services
  • Experience with tool analysis and selection
  • Experience with OpenTelemetry implementation and configuration
  • Experience with distributed log aggregation, analysis, and alarming
  • Experience with the Java/JVM ecosystem and troubleshooting
  • Experience with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C)
  • CI/CD pipeline implementation and maintenance experience (Jenkins preferred)
  • Preferred experience:
  • Experience with security, particularly security infrastructure design
  • Experience playing an active role in developing and shipping SaaS products
  • Practical knowledge of Kubernetes clusters and workloads
  • Understanding of EKS architecture and AWS integration
  • Experience migrating services from ECS to Kubernetes
  • Experience with Terraform and understanding of Terraform modules and best practices
  • Experience with state management and versioning approaches
  • Experience implementing true Continuous Deployment, including automated testing integration in deployment workflows
  • Experience with frontend builds and Gradle build tools
  • Experience with multi-environment deployment
  • Experience with chaos engineering and resilience testing

Pay

Based on the Sacramento region, the new hires minimum and maximum target salary for this role is $140k - $160k.

Inductive Automation’s ranges are market-driven and set to allow for flexibility. Although it is not typical for an individual to start at the top end of the range for the position, compensation decisions are dependent on: the facts and circumstances of each case, work location, job-related skills, experience, relevant education or training; and other business and organizational needs.
